U.P: Three suspended after boy falls in open sewer, dies

Lucknow, April 26 (UNI) Two engineers and a supervisor were suspended following the death of an eight-year-old boy who had fallen into an open sewer, an official spokesman said here on Friday.
The spokesman said that on April 23 Shahrukh Khan, a resident of sector 7 in Jankipuram colony, fell into an open sewer. "After getting the information the minister directed the departmental officials to reach the spot and take necessary action," he said.
He said that Municipal Commissioner Indrajeet Singh reached the spot and the boy was rescued from an 18 feet deep sewer in a joint operation by the teams of NDRF, SDRF and firefighters. "He was taken to the trauma center where Shahrukh died. Minister Sharma has issued a directive to conduct a departmental inquiry and take stern action against the guilty," he said.
